this is a true story. I befriended an elderly client with no family, as she was in great need of help. We did a lot to help her get her affairs in order. We also got her appropriate living arrangements and helped her in a variety of other ways.

I then filed an unclaimed property search because I noticed she had many parcels of Mail that were unopened dating back many years and among those were tons of dividend checks from stock positions she had. These were never cashed. Turns out I was able to recover for her over $500,000 in assets from unclaimed property. I was also aware that her brother passed away about 10 years prior. The unclaimed property search also showed he had assets which we recovered that were well over $500,000.

Incidentally when my client passed away, she had no family. She had four nieces from whom she was long estranged.
Imagine how they felt when I called them to tell them they were each inheriting around $600,000 from their long-lost aunt.

These things really do happen sometimes!

In NJ, you can see what the items are before you file. The paperwork for most claims is not that difficult -- basically, you need to prove that you're the person entitled to the money and furnish proof of your social security number so that they can send you a 1099 at the end of the year if the unclaimed property accrued more than $10 of interest. The more difficult claims are claims on behalf of deceased individuals.

What your brother needs to do is to go to the county where her estate was probated and get a letter of administration. That should be submitted with her death certificate, proof of your brother's identity, and proof of his social security number. If the estate ever got an employee identification number, it would be good to submit proof of that, which can be gotten by calling the IRS. Only you and your brother can decide whether the amount of money is worth doing all this.
